Upgrades the jjwt-jackson module's Jackson dependency to 2.9.10.3.
Fixes an issue when using Java 9+ Map.of with JacksonDeserializer that resulted in an NullPointerException.
Fixes an issue that prevented the jjwt-gson .jar's seralizer/deserializer implementation from being detected automatically.
Ensures service implementations are now loaded from the context class loader, Services.class.classLoader, and the system classloader, the first classloader with a service wins, and the others are ignored. This mimics how Classes.forName() works, and how JJWT attempted to auto-discover various implementations in previous versions.
Fixes a minor error in the Claims#getIssuedAt JavaDoc.
Updates the Jackson dependency version to 2.9.10
to address three security vulnerabilities in Jackson.
A new JwtParserBuilder interface has been added and is the recommended way of creating an immutable and thread-safe JwtParser instance. Mutable methods in JwtParser will be removed before v1.0.
